1. Material Considerations for Die Casting Molds

One of the most significant factors in die casting mold selection is the material used for construction. Molds are typically made from steel or aluminum, each offering different benefits.

  • Steel molds are durable and can withstand high pressures, making them suitable for long production runs. However, they come with a higher initial cost.
  • Aluminum molds, on the other hand, are lighter and less expensive, ideal for lower volume production or prototyping.

When choosing the mold material, consider factors like the production volume, complexity of the parts, and the desired lifespan of the mold.

2. Design and Complexity of the Mold

The complexity of the part design directly impacts the die casting mold's purchasing decision. Intricate designs may require more sophisticated molds, which can drive up costs.

  • Consider modular designs: These can reduce costs and allow for easier maintenance and repairs.
  • Utilize computer-aided design (CAD): Investing in CAD software can help visualize the mold's design and predict potential issues before production starts.

Evaluate the design requirements carefully to ensure that the selected die casting mold can handle the necessary specifications while remaining cost-effective.

3. Production Capacity and Lead Time

Assessing your production capacity and lead time is vital when deciding on a die casting mold. The scale and speed of production can influence the type of mold needed.

  • High-volume production may justify investing in more expensive, durable molds, whereas low-volume requirements might necessitate more economical options.
  • Lead time is also crucial. If your project requires a rapid turnaround, consider suppliers with a proven track record of quick production.

Understanding your production needs can streamline the selection process and help you avoid delays in getting your product to market.

Common Questions about Die Casting Mold Purchasing Decisions

What is the typical lifespan of a die casting mold?

The lifespan of a die casting mold varies depending on factors like the material used, production volume, and maintenance practices. Generally, steel molds can last for thousands of cycles, while aluminum molds have shorter life spans but can be suitable for smaller production runs.

How do I know if I need a custom mold?

If your part designs are unique or complex, or if standard molds do not meet your production needs, you may require a custom mold. An evaluation of your design specifications and production requirements can help you determine this.

Are there ways to reduce the cost of die casting molds?

Yes, several strategies can help reduce costs, including: optimizing part design for manufacturability, investing in modular molds for flexibility, and sourcing quotes from multiple suppliers to find the best deal.
